From 68d6539130d5957d50950d259e85707af7d99d27 Mon Sep 17 00:00:00 2001 From: moecinnamo Date: Fri, 12 Sep 2025 14:42:50 +0800 Subject: [PATCH] add PSRAM detecting --- main/CMakeLists.txt | 2 +- main/main.cc | 7 +++++++ 2 files changed, 8 insertions(+), 1 deletion(-) diff --git a/main/CMakeLists.txt b/main/CMakeLists.txt index 2527937..4b495ed 100644 --- a/main/CMakeLists.txt +++ b/main/CMakeLists.txt @@ -23,7 +23,7 @@ set(SOURCES "audio/audio_codec.cc" "ota.cc" "settings.cc" "device_state_event.cc" - "main.cc" + ) set(INCLUDE_DIRS "." "display" "audio" "protocols") diff --git a/main/main.cc b/main/main.cc index c4bce23..b721580 100755 --- a/main/main.cc +++ b/main/main.cc @@ -24,6 +24,13 @@ extern "C" void app_main(void) } ESP_ERROR_CHECK(ret); + // Detecting PSRAM + if (esp_spiram_is_initialized()) { + ESP_LOGI("PSRAM", "PSRAM is available and initialized."); + } else { + ESP_LOGE("PSRAM", "PSRAM not found or not initialized."); + } + // Launch the application auto& app = Application::GetInstance(); app.Start();